Caso's newest track, "Lick in Style," is full of swagger and mixes danger and attraction, wrapping naughty energy in a shiny, confident sheen. The song plays with a funny truth: sometimes people look their best when they're doing something bad. Caso takes that idea and makes it into a bold, rhythmic statement that sounds both rebellious and really cool.
Caso fully embraces the tension between how things look and how they are meant to be, creating a world where charm is a weapon and confidence is money. The rhythm has a smooth, easy bounce that makes it feel like the perfect background for late-night adventures, neon-lit streets, and times when style is its own kind of bad behavior.
"Lick in Style" stands out because Caso balances courage with finesse. The song does not glorify trouble; instead, it explores the thrill of navigating the delicate balance between danger and allure. The delivery has a cinematic edge that makes you feel like you're stepping into a scene where everyone's motives are questionable, but everyone looks great doing it.
The strength of the single lies in Caso's ability to turn a simple idea into a whole sensory experience. He skillfully establishes the atmosphere, allowing the listeners to fill in the details. The production is smooth but punchy, stylish but grounded, which fits the song's theme of looking good even when things get a little messy. "Lick in Style" is a cool and confident addition to Caso's catalog. It encourages listeners to embrace their edge, trust their swagger, and lean into the times when style and mischief go hand in hand.
